| bkenobi:
On a higher end (for the day) set with a decent source, svideo looks marginally better than composite. IMO the difference is unlikely to be night and day. |
| RayB:
Depends on the device and quality of the television. Take a Super Nintendo for example, plugged to a new high quality CRT, and you'll see it's sharper with SVHS than composite. But I'd assume that hooking either cable up to a cheap TV will look pretty much the same (that is, not as nice as the quality TV! ;D) |
| DJ_Izumi:
On my 27" TV, S-Video is a great improvement since it eliminates composite dot crawl and is shaper. Only my digital cable box is on S-Video though, the game consoles I do on component and it's lovely, bright and sharp. :) |
